Finding the Right Non-Wireless Printer: A Simple Guide
Printers are still super useful! Even though “wireless” sounds fancy, sometimes a wired printer is the best choice for your home or office. This guide will help you pick the perfect one.
Why Choose a Non-Wireless Printer?
Non-wireless printers connect directly to your computer using a USB cable. This connection is often faster and more reliable than Wi-Fi. It’s also a great option if your Wi-Fi is spotty or if you want to avoid network security worries.
Key Features to Look For
1. Print Speed
This tells you how fast the printer can print pages. Look for pages per minute (PPM). A higher PPM means faster printing.
2. Print Resolution
This is like the sharpness of your prints. It’s measured in dots per inch (DPI). Higher DPI means clearer text and images.
3. Ink or Toner Type
There are two main types: inkjet and laser.
- Inkjet printers use liquid ink. They are good for printing photos and color documents.
- Laser printers use powder toner. They are great for printing lots of text quickly and clearly.
4. All-in-One Capabilities
Some non-wireless printers can also scan and copy. This is super handy if you need one machine for multiple tasks.
5. Paper Handling
Think about the types and sizes of paper you’ll print on. Some printers handle different paper weights and sizes better than others. Also, check the paper tray capacity. A bigger tray means you won’t have to refill it as often.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Factors That Improve Quality:
- High DPI: Results in sharper prints.
- Good Ink/Toner: Using quality ink or toner cartridges makes a big difference.
- Regular Maintenance: Cleaning the print heads (for inkjet) or following the manufacturer’s cleaning instructions keeps your printer working well.
Factors That Reduce Quality:
- Low DPI: Prints can look fuzzy.
- Using Cheap Ink/Toner: This can lead to poor color and smudging.
- Not Cleaning the Printer: Dust and dried ink can clog the printer.
- Connecting with a Bad Cable: A damaged USB cable can cause printing errors.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Are non-wireless printers hard to set up?
A: No, most are very easy. You just plug them in and follow the on-screen instructions on your computer.
Q: Can I connect a non-wireless printer to multiple computers?
A: Not at the same time. It connects to one computer at a time using the USB cable. You would have to move the cable or use a USB switch if you wanted to share it.
Q: What’s the difference between inkjet and laser printers?
A: Inkjet printers use liquid ink for color and photos. Laser printers use powder toner for sharp text and fast printing.
Q: How do I know if I need an all-in-one printer?
A: If you need to scan documents or make copies, an all-in-one is a good choice. It saves space and money.
Q: Will a non-wireless printer work with my Mac or Windows computer?
A: Yes, most printers come with software for both Mac and Windows.
Q: How often do I need to buy new ink or toner?
A: It depends on how much you print. High-yield cartridges last longer.
Q: Can I print photos with a non-wireless printer?
A: Yes, especially with inkjet printers designed for photo printing. Look for good DPI.
Q: Is a USB cable good enough for printing?
A: Yes, USB connections are very reliable and often faster than wireless for direct printing.
Q: What if my printer isn’t printing clearly?
A: Try running the printer’s cleaning utility. Also, check your ink or toner levels and use good quality cartridges.
Q: Are non-wireless printers cheaper than wireless ones?
A: Often, yes. The printer itself can be less expensive, and you save on potential Wi-Fi setup costs.
